Big Little Touches Lake Lanier rental home stocks up on amenities

Y

ou never really know what you’re going to get with a rental home. Sometimes the photos online may make it look bigger and better than it is, or the space may lack items that are needed for a comfortable stay. That is not the case at Southern Shore Cove, a short-term rental home located on the shores of Lake Lanier in Flowery Branch. Purchased in September 2020, the spacious six-bedroom, three-floor home underwent a huge remodel and feels like the owners have thought of everything to keep their guests comfortable. The responsive and flexible host made booking a weekend stay with my family (including two dogs and a few friends) a breeze. We communicated directly to coordinate this trip, but the house can be booked through

the home’s website, Airbnb or VRBO. After the short 45-minute drive from Atlanta and an easy key code entry, the fun starts (but doesn’t stop) in two game rooms of every little and big kid’s dreams. One takes place in the garage with a pool table, shufflepuck, vintage arcade games and a buffet of complimentary candy and snacks; the other downstairs features a card table and a stack of board games for every age, perfect for game night or a rainy day. A chessboard surrounded by plush seating beckons players near the front entrance and a cozy movie-watching space downstairs featuring more snacks on a lazy Susan and one of 10 big-screen smart TVs. Crank up the tunes on the surround-sound Sonos speakers for a soundtrack to your good time. Tucked into a wooded lot, Southern

Shore Cove offers ample private outdoor hangout spaces including a screened-in porch with a picnic bench; a back deck with a grill, large dining table, couches and hot tub; a fire pit area; a hammock; and a lower patio featuring an outdoor shower. The view is more trees than lake, so you’ll need to walk down a path toward the dock offset to the right of the property to get that onthe-water feeling. Several kayaks and paddleboards are available for lake exploration. You can also rent or bring a boat, as we did, and park it in the boat slip. Fishing poles are available to add to the lake life experience. While they might take a backseat to the shared spaces, the bedrooms are equally comfortable. With three king rooms, two queen rooms and a spacious bunk room with four full beds and two optional trundles, there’s space for several friends or families. Just like the rest of the home, each room is well-decorated in mostly neutrals and blue tones with a beachmeets-lake vibe (think oars, shiplap panels and coral accessories). Our group had a blast cooking up a storm in the fully stocked kitchen, marveling at how it had everything from a slow cooker to a rice maker. Other thoughtful amenities included face masks and hand sanitizer, bikes, umbrellas and coffee bars. In a nutshell, this rental property is flawlessly outfitted for a stay-and-play visit.
